More about the book
David Herbert Lawrence's works delve into the dehumanizing impacts of modernity and industrialization, examining themes such as sexuality, emotional well-being, and the importance of instinct and spontaneity. His writings reflect a deep contemplation of the human experience, highlighting the struggles against societal constraints and the quest for vitality in an increasingly mechanized world.
